let us discuss about the properties of right angle triangle~

one angle is always 90° or right angle.

The side opposite angle 90° is the hypotenuse.

The hypotenuse is always the longest side.

The sum of the other two interior angle is equal to 90°.

The other two sides adjacent to the right angle are called base and perpendicular.

The area of right angle triangle is equal to half of the product of adjacent sides of the right angle, i.e.,

Area of Right Angle Triangle =\frac{1}{2} (Base × Perpendicular)

If we drop a perpendicular from the right angle to the hypotenuse, we will get three similar triangles.

If we draw a circumcircle which passes through all three vertices, then the radius of this circle is equal to half of the length of the hypotenuse.

If one of the angles is 90° and the other two angles are equal to 450 each, then the triangle is called an Isosceles Right Angled Triangle, where the adjacent sides to 90° are equal in length to each other.
